DragonFly commits List (threaded) for 2007-01
[
Date Prev][
Date Next]
[
Thread Prev][
Thread Next]
[
Date Index][
Thread Index]
cvs commit: src/sys/dev/virtual/net if_vke.c src/sys/machine/vkernel/conf files src/sys/machine/vkernel/i386 exception.c src/sys/machine/vkernel/include md_var.h src/sys/machine/vkernel/platform init.c kqueue.c machintr.c systimer.c
dillon 2007/01/14 17:29:04 PST
DragonFly src repository
Modified files:
sys/dev/virtual/net if_vke.c
sys/machine/vkernel/conf files
sys/machine/vkernel/i386 exception.c
sys/machine/vkernel/include md_var.h
sys/machine/vkernel/platform init.c machintr.c systimer.c
Added files:
sys/machine/vkernel/platform kqueue.c
Log:
Add kqueue based async I/O support to the virtual kernel. Convert VKE to
use the new async I/O support for reading.
Setup SIGIO as a SA_MAILBOX signal for efficiency. Remove remaining signal
masks from sigaction() calls.
Revision Changes Path
1.3 +14 -54 src/sys/dev/virtual/net/if_vke.c
1.14 +1 -0 src/sys/machine/vkernel/conf/files
1.4 +20 -0 src/sys/machine/vkernel/i386/exception.c
1.15 +8 -0 src/sys/machine/vkernel/include/md_var.h
1.27 +1 -0 src/sys/machine/vkernel/platform/init.c
1.10 +1 -1 src/sys/machine/vkernel/platform/machintr.c
1.9 +0 -46 src/sys/machine/vkernel/platform/systimer.c
http://www.dragonflybsd.org/cvsweb/src/sys/dev/virtual/net/if_vke.c.diff?r1=1.2&r2=1.3&f=u
http://www.dragonflybsd.org/cvsweb/src/sys/machine/vkernel/conf/files.diff?r1=1.13&r2=1.14&f=u
http://www.dragonflybsd.org/cvsweb/src/sys/machine/vkernel/i386/exception.c.diff?r1=1.3&r2=1.4&f=u
http://www.dragonflybsd.org/cvsweb/src/sys/machine/vkernel/include/md_var.h.diff?r1=1.14&r2=1.15&f=u
http://www.dragonflybsd.org/cvsweb/src/sys/machine/vkernel/platform/init.c.diff?r1=1.26&r2=1.27&f=u
http://www.dragonflybsd.org/cvsweb/src/sys/machine/vkernel/platform/machintr.c.diff?r1=1.9&r2=1.10&f=u
http://www.dragonflybsd.org/cvsweb/src/sys/machine/vkernel/platform/systimer.c.diff?r1=1.8&r2=1.9&f=u
[
Date Prev][
Date Next]
[
Thread Prev][
Thread Next]
[
Date Index][
Thread Index]